Synopsis[]
Jules is disappointed by Grayson's lack of faith; Grayson signs up the gang for a dodgeball game; Travis and Andy try to set up Bobby on a date with his new friend; and Ellie is worried that Andy doesn't find her attractive anymore.

Trivia[]
- Whenever Andy says "as mayor...", whoever touches their nose last has to crab walk.
- "Donald Trump" means not cool at all.
- Jules named her giant seagull "Mr. Beakington".
- The Cul-de-Sac Crew's religious preferences:
- Jules is nonspecific religious.
- Grayson is atheist/agonistic.
- Ellie is New England Catholic.
- Andy is Latin American Catholic.
- Travis has been experimenting with different religious in college.
- Laurie's various stepfathers were Jewish, Methodist, Buddhist, Quacker, and Snake Charmer, so her religious is kind of one of those fountain drinks you put a splash of every soda in until its full.
- Jules' worst nightmare is being attacked by a thousand birds, and her second worst nightmare is being hit in the face with balls.
